The attacker Erickwhich the Coritiba made an offer for a definitive purchase, received an even bigger offer to remain in the Victory. The 28-year-old player, who belongs to and is out of São Paulo’s plans, was at Leão on loan in 2025.

However, the Bahian club exceeded the values ​​offered by Coxa, according to the ge. Vitória had made a proposal of R$5 millionand the Alviverde proposed an agreement for R$5.5 million. However, the red-black team increased the player’s purchase price by R$7 million.

As a result, the striker must remain and sign a three-year contract with Vitória. The athlete is seen as a fundamental piece and was a request from coach Jair Ventura for next season. In 2025, Erick scored three goals and provided five assists in 38 matches, helping to avoid the team’s decline in the Brasileirão.

Erick’s History

Revealed by Náutico in 2017, Erick aroused the interest of European teams in his first season and was bought by Braga, from Portugal. In the following two seasons, he played on loan at Vitória. Afterwards, he was loaned to Gil Vicente, from Portugal, and Náutico.

In 2021, he definitively arrived in Ceará, where he stayed for three seasons. He aroused the interest of São Paulo after scoring 18 goals and distributing 13 assists in 52 games in 2023. The striker transferred to Morumbi free of charge after the end of his contract with Vozão.

Last year, there were 36 games, with three goals and four assists, for the São Paulo team. In 2025, he played just eight games at Paulistão before being loaned to Vitória.
